Airlines Provide Meals as U.S. Shutdown Strains Aviation

Story summary
  • The U.S. government shutdown has lasted 33 days, leaving federal aviation workers unpaid.
  • American Airlines and United Airlines are providing free meals to support about 13,000 air traffic controllers and 50,000 TSA officers.
  • Despite airline aid, the aviation system remains strained, with staffing shortages causing delays and longer security lines.
  • The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) warns unpaid workers may face fatigue, and Congress must act to resolve the shutdown.
